50-Year Rust Perforation Warranty

Every Buildway steel building kit is backed by a 50-year rust perforation warranty on all Galvalume Plus™ steel panels and structural components. It means your building will keep its strength and fight off rust for years to come. Just make sure it’s set up and maintained correctly.

What’s Covered

  • Rust Perforation: We cover any rust that causes perforation of steel panels or structural members for 50 years from the date of delivery.

  • Manufacturing Defects: All materials are covered against manufacturing defects that exist at the time of delivery.

  • Engineered Components: Warranty applies to all pre-engineered steel components supplied directly by Buildway.

  • Paint Finish: Galvalume Plus™ panels include a manufacturer’s paint warranty of 40–50 years, depending on the panel type.

  • Limited One-Year Coverage: All other components we supply (fasteners, trim, hardware, etc.) are covered for 12 months against manufacturer defects.

What’s Not Covered

  • Third-party accessories such as doors, windows, or insulation that are not manufactured by Buildway.
  • Improper storage, handling, or installation.
  • Damage from site conditions such as poor drainage, inadequate foundations, or standing water.
  • Unauthorized modifications or field alterations (e.g., welding, unapproved openings).
  • Exposure to corrosive chemicals, saltwater/marine environments, fertilizers, or treated lumber beyond normal conditions.
  • Condensation, mold, cosmetic discoloration, chalking, or fading that does not cause perforation.
  • Acts of nature outside the engineered design loads (storms, flooding, earthquakes).

Customer Responsibilities

To maintain warranty coverage, customers must:

  • Follow Installation Guidelines: Buildings must be erected according to the engineered drawings and specifications provided.
  • Obtain Permits & Code Approvals: Local building permits and inspections are the responsibility of the owner or their contractor.
  • Prepare the Site Properly: Adequate foundation, drainage, and site preparation are required to prevent issues that could void coverage.
  • Perform Regular Maintenance: Remove debris, check for standing water, inspect cut edges for white rust, and seal as needed. Annual maintenance is strongly recommended.

How to File a Warranty Claim

If you believe you have a valid warranty claim:

  1. Document the Issue: Take clear photos and note the location and description of the problem.
  2. Contact Buildway: Call +1 855-944-1515 or email [email protected] with your order details, photos, and a written description of the issue.
  3. Inspection & Review: Buildway will review your claim and may request additional information or an on-site inspection.
  4. Resolution: If approved, Buildway will repair or replace defective materials with comparable materials at our discretion. Here are a few important points to keep in mind:
    • The customer pays shipping for replacement materials and any required return shipping.
    • Labor, removal, reinstallation, equipment, and travel costs are not covered.
    • Total claim value cannot exceed the original purchase price of the building.

Claims must be submitted in writing within 30 days of discovering the defect, and will expire if not filed within 1 year of when the defect first appears.

Do I need a licensed contractor to install my building for the warranty to apply?

No. Your warranty remains valid whether you hire a professional or build it yourself, as long as the building is erected according to the engineered drawings and specifications. Proof of licensed installation isn’t required, but the structure must meet the design loads and follow the provided plans.
